Eid-el-Kabir – Senator Daduut felicitates with Muslims , says Nigeria on the path of progress under President Tinubu

By Israel Adamu,Jos

Immediate Past Senator representing Plateau South in the National Assembly Prof Dame Nora Ladi Daduut ,on Tuesday urged Nigerians to use this Eid el-Kabir festival to Pray for President Bola Tinubu, and his Vice, Sen. Kashim Shettima, as well as the first lady of the Federation Oluremi Tinubu as they work to put the Nation on the path of progress .

In her message to Muslims of the country ,she urged Nigerians to use this period to pray for peace, unity and development of the country and to also pray for President Bola Tinubu to continue to succeed.

Daduut also applauded President Bola Tinubu’s appointments and economic decisions, saying they will strengthen and build confidence in the country .
